Distinctive Tastes: Top Premium Cigars to Enjoy
Cigar aficionados often discover that regional influences have a substantial role in the flavor profiles of high-quality cigars. For example, Nicaraguan cigars are celebrated for their bold, ground-forward flavors, often complemented by notes of chocolate and spice. The celebrated Padron series demonstrates this complexity, making it an must-try for aficionados. Meanwhile, Dominican cigars, such as those from Arturo Fuente, provide a gentler, more subdued experience, often featuring floral notes and delicate sugar notes.
Cuba serves as the ultimate standard, with Cohiba and Montecristo offering memorable blends that balance creaminess with robust taste elements. Additionally, Honduran cigars, like those from Alec Bradley, exhibit a bold mix of pepper and earthy wood tones, appealing to those pursuing a more formidable smoke. Analyzing these geographic variations facilitates enthusiasts to appreciate the rich tapestry of tastes that superior cigars furnish, augmenting the overall cigar venue setting.

Learning Cigar Customs
Visiting a cigar bar gainfully copyrights on grasping the silent customs of cigar etiquette. Guests should kick off by selecting a cigar that aligns with their palate, not giving in to smoking someone else’s choice without consent. Lighting a cigar is a skill; using a quality lighter and toasting the foot prior to enjoyment is essential. It’s respectful to avoid creating dense smoke in tight spaces, and never put out a cigar in someone else's drink. When smoking, one should take measured drags, allowing the cigar to rest between puffs. Conversations are recommended, but it’s important to be conscious of the atmosphere. Lastly, tipping the staff generously for their expertise boosts the overall experience and shows recognition for their care.

Do Cigar Bars have particular attire guidelines?
Cigar bars commonly demand a smart casual clothing standard, underscoring comfort while upholding an upscale atmosphere. Patrons are normally urged to dress neatly, eschewing overly casual attire such as shorts, flip-flops, or excessively graphic clothing.
May I Transport My Personal Cigars?
Many cigar bars permit patrons to bring their own cigars, although some may have restrictions. It is advisable to check the specific policies of the establishment beforehand to verify compliance with their requirements.
What Health Issues Result From Smoking Cigars?
Smoking cigars introduces serious health complications, comprising lung cancer, heart disease, and respiratory issues. The inhalation of tobacco smoke also raises the likelihood of oral cancers and can lead to nicotine addiction, altering overall well-being.
Is There an Age Limit for Entering Cigar Bars?
Most cigar bars establish an age limit, typically mandating patrons to be at least 18 or 21 years old, based on local laws. This rule ensures adherence with regulations surrounding tobacco consumption and access.
Are Non-Smoking Areas present at Cigar Bars?
Cigar bars usually do not offer non-smoking areas, since the primary focus is on the cigar enjoyment. However, certain establishments may offer special areas or separate rooms for guests who desire reduced smoke exposure.
